[Update] FolderSizes 4.6.0.42

FolderSizes Release Notes
Maintained by Mark Richards (mark@keymetricsoft.com) of Key Metric Software

Version 4.6.0.42 (Released June 5th, 2008)

Various minor (mostly cosmetic) bug fixes.
Version 4.6.0.40 (Released June 1st, 2008)

Bug fix: Resolved a problem where paths greater than 260 characters would cause a runtime error in some scenarios.
Bug fix: The "research file extension" function of the FolderSizes file / folder context menu was not properly enabled in some circumstances.
Bug fix: The search facility would fail when attempting to show full folder paths exceeding 260 characters in length.
Bug fix: Resolved a problem with the integrated Windows shell context menu not displaying all items properly in certain circumstances.
Feature: Improved handling of very long paths in several ways, including improved drill-down into long paths from the Folder Browser, handling of long paths in the main window Path entry field, and more.
